Stories from Inauguration Day streets
Feb. 10, 2009
Ken Koontz gathered together a film crew and covered the stories on the streets of Washington during Inauguration Day.
He was at the Forum Tuesday showing video from that effort. DVDs containing a selection of the coverage made by the film crew will be available at the Forum on Feb. 17.
In one selection, footage of Barack Obama's swearing-in was woven into archival shots of violence on the Pettus Bridge during the Selma-to-Montgomery civil rights march, and of one of Martin Luther King Jr.'s last speeches before his assassination.
Another focused on a celebration of King Day at a District of Columbia church. Another focused on vendors on the streets on Inauguration Day.
Koontz owns WENS-TV, an Internet-based video service. Some of his video reports
